Fitting a milling tool
In order to use a milling tool (max. cutting width 20mm), first proceed as descri-
bed in point 1-8 in the previous section.
Then proceed as follows:
1. Remove the riving knife, cushioning disc and screws in the centre table
strip
2. Remove the front part of the centre table strip
3. Place the milling cutter and front flange onto the saw shaft, turn in the
expansion-head screw by hand and tighten it with the wrench.
4. Retract the riving knife block completely and tighten the clamping screw of
the riving knife holding fixture
5. Close the red protective cover and perform a short test run to see whether
the milling cutter is running freely. Do this by lowering the top protection
hood down to the table so that the milling cutter is completely covered.
Fig. 6-27 See point 1
Warning!
When returning to normal processing with a saw blade, adhere to the fol-
lowing:
Non-adherence to these points may lead to severe injuries of the opera-
tor!
Reinsert the disassembled centre table strip; only use original brass
screws for fastening
Reinstall the cushioning disc
Reinstall and correctly adjust the riving knife
